Political Science
DS of political science at VSE offers extending of knowledge in the branch of Policy and political sciences. Owing to common economic basis of doctoral study at VSE the graduate gains combined knowledge of economics and policy, which is one of the key connections for understanding a modern world. This study can be recommended both to people who want to be professional politicians and to people from the economic sphere, who are in a daily contact with politics. Doctoral study of political science can be recommended above all to the researchers who want to deal with the political science professionally as scientists or pedagogues
Political ScienceBlock A: Subjects common to the whole school:FIL901 Philosophy and methodology science*MO_922 Research Metodology** Doctoral student chooses one of the two subjects on recommendation of a supervisor.MIE911 Economics (microeconomics-macroeconomics)*MAE911 Economics (macroeconomics-microeconomics)*HP_911 Economics (economic policy)** Doctoral student chooses one of the three subjects on recommendation of a supervisor.Block B: Branch compulsory subjects: POL900 Theory of politics and lawPOL901 Czech constitutional and political system *POL902 Comparative politics*POL903 Development of political ideologies and theories*POL905 Sociology of politics*POL908 European politics in transition*POL915 European political integration** Doctoral student chooses one of the fourteen subjects on recommendation of a supervisor.Block C: Optional subjectsAfter discussion with his/her supervisor the doctoral student chooses other subjects needed for the doctoral thesis. Main stress is put on working out a doctoral thesis, which should reflect specialization of a doctoral student (commercial or financial sphere), on its independence and quality (individual study, professional practice, orientation in foreign sources), and on successful defense of suggested views and conclusions

Take testAdmission to a Doctoral Study Programme is conditional upon the proper completion of studies in a Masters´Study Programme. The Master´s Diploma must be recognized in the Czech Republic. Applicants are admitted to the Doctoral Study Programme on the basis of their entrance examinations results and subject to the availability of suitable supervisors.
